The shelf’s open-concept structure is intentionally designed to empower children to independently select and return toys or books, fostering a sense of responsibility. Unlike traditional toy boxes that can overwhelm young children, each tier provides clear visibility and easy reach. Functionality extends beyond storage. The open shelves double as a display area for rotating toys and books, which aligns with Montessori principles of offering curated choices to stimulate curiosity.
